If mean and coefficient of variation of the marks of 10\displaystyle 10 students is 20\displaystyle 20 and 80\displaystyle 80 respectively. What will be the variance of them?

Options

A256\displaystyle 256
B16\displaystyle 16
C25\displaystyle 25
DNone of these

Detailed Solution & Explanation

**Given:** Mean xˉ=20\displaystyle \bar{x} = 20, CV = 80 **Step 1: Find SD.** CV=σxˉ×100CV = \frac{\sigma}{\bar{x}} \times 100 80=σ20×10080 = \frac{\sigma}{20} \times 100 σ=80×20100=16\sigma = \frac{80 \times 20}{100} = 16 **Step 2: Find Variance.** σ2=162=256\sigma^2 = 16^2 = 256 Hence, **Option A** is the correct answer.

Exam Strategy Tip

Do not just memorize formulas; ICAI loves asking about the mathematical properties (e.g., 'sum of deviations from the AM is always zero'). You can usually eliminate 2 options just by knowing the properties.
